[Tutorial] Comandos Bбsicos - Iniciantes em Pawno.
#1

Bom Galera. Eu tambйm sou iniciante, mais vou passar a vocкs uma parte do que eu jб aprendi nesse tutorial. Esse й meu Primeiro Tutorial, E nele, vou ensinar a vocк fazer alguns comandos bбsicos.

Primeiramente. Faзa o download da Include ZCMD :

http://www.solidfiles.com/d/d20f/ - Com Essa Include, serб bem mais fбcil criar um comando no seu GameMode.

Instalando a Include :

Apos Baixar a include ( Arquivo.inc ) Vocк deverб bota lб dentro da pasta - Pawno - Include.

Apos ter feito isso, Abra teu GameMode.


Criando um Comando :
Dentro do teu GameMode, Vб na parte superior, e Embaixo do nome #include <a_samp> Bote isso :
pawn Код:
#include <zcmd>
Isso Serve, Para a Include Funcionar no seu Gm.

Ok, Agora vamos criar alguns comandos no seu GM:

Teleporte:
1є Vб onde serб o local do teleporte dentro do Game, e Digite /save Teleporte

2є Entre no seu GameMode e Crie o comando assim :


pawn Код:
CMD:comando(playerid, params [])
{
    SetPlayerPos(playerid,Coordenada);
    return 1;
}
Comando : O comando que o player digitarб para fazer o teleporte.
Coordenada : Para Pegar a Coordenada que vocк tirou do Game ( /save ... ) Vб na pasta -
C:\Users\Lucas\Documents\GTA San Andreas User Files\SAMP E abra o Arquivo savedpositions

OK. Agora Copie as primeiras 6 " Casas " De numeros depois da Primeira Virgula .

Exemplo :


AddPlayerClass(230,-2301.1223,1545.0208,18.9006,91.0658,0,0,0,0,0,0);

Essas sгo as coordenadas !

Agora Copie e Cole no seu comando.


Comando Para Dar Armas ( KIT )
Agora vamos aprender, a como criar um comando, em que o player digitarб e ganharб armas.

Observe

pawn Код:
CMD:comando(playerid, params [])
{
    GivePlayerWeapon(playerid,ID DA ARMA,MUNIЗГO);
    return 1;
}
Aqui vocк pode ver todos IDs de armas https://sampwiki.blast.hk/wiki/Weapons

Caso Queira adicionar mais armas :

pawn Код:
CMD:comando(playerid, params [])
{
    GivePlayerWeapon(playerid,ID DA 1Є ARMA,MUNIЗГO);
    GivePlayerWeapon(playerid,ID DA 2Є ARMA,MUNIЗГO);
    GivePlayerWeapon(playerid,ID DA 3Є ARMA,MUNIЗГO);
    GivePlayerWeapon(playerid,ID DA 4Є ARMA,MUNIЗГO);
    GivePlayerWeapon(playerid,ID DA 5Є ARMA,MUNIЗГO);
    return 1;
}
E assim vai ...

Adicionando Mensagens aos comandos:


Simples ! Basta fazer assim :

pawn Код:
CMD:comando(playerid, params [])
{
    Coisa que vai ter no comando....
    SendClientMessage(playerid,0xFF9933AA," MENSБGEM " );  
    return 1;
}
0xFF9933AA й a cor da mensбgem. vocк pode ver alguns exemplos de cores aqui : http://pastebin.com/vTS9yRzJ

Entгo galera. por enquanto й so isso, to sem tempo agora, depoois eu boto mais coisas. Espero que ajude rsrs
Reply
#2

бrea errada, lol.
Reply
#3

Comando que nгo utiliza parвmetro nгo precisa colocar params[]

E isso estб muito bбsico, tem na wiki.
Reply
#4

Era so uma ajuda mesmo
Reply
#5

Esta na area errada amigo.
Reply
#6

Alguйm bota na Бrea certa ?
Reply
#7

Nгo tem como mover, й sу da um edit no tуpico e colocar area errada, e depois crie um na area de lanзamentos
Reply


Forum Jump:


Users browsing this thread: 2 Guest(s)